Anklets, also known as ankle bracelets or ankle chains, are decorative items worn around the ankle. They have been worn by many cultures throughout history (for over 8000 years!) and have various meanings and cultural significance. Some see it as a sign of beauty that is often worn by women, in other cultures, it is seen as a sign of wealth and status. In some countries, an anklet is seen as a way to ward off evil spirits, so what does wearing an anklet mean? Well, it really depends on the culture you come from.

Do Anklets Have a Meaning?

When you first consider wearing an anklet, you might be thinking: 'Does wearing an anklet mean anything?'. Surprisingly enough, anklets are some of the oldest known pieces of jewellery, they've been around since at least 6000 BC. There is evidence that even women in Babylon may have worn ankle bracelets. In the beginning, anklets were created from wood, bone, and even precious metals. They were used as a fashion statement, as well as a symbol of social status. 

Egyptians used the word 'Khalakheel' to describe anklets. Only Sumerian women and brides of the time could afford ones that featured gemstones and precious metals, slaves wore anklets made of leather or wood.

In Western culture, anklets have often been associated with women and femininity. They were popular in the 1920s and have seen a resurgence in popularity in recent years.

In some cultures, anklets are also believed to have spiritual or supernatural powers. They are worn to ward off evil spirits, bring good luck, or as a form of protection. Overall, the meaning and cultural significance of anklets can vary widely depending on the context and culture in which they are worn.

Do Anklets Go on the Left or Right?

An anklet can be worn on any ankle. While there are some symbolic meanings and cultural significance in some cultures, in western culture, there are no underlying messages that are prevalent. You can decide which ankle feels the most comfortable for your jewellery. Some people like to coordinate their ankle jewellery with their bracelets: choose to wear them on the same side or alternate. 

What Does an Anklet on the Left Ankle Mean?

Anklets worn on the left ankle can have different meanings depending on the culture or context in which they are worn. In some cultures, an anklet worn on the left ankle can indicate that the person wearing it is married or in a committed relationship. 

In other cultures, an anklet worn on the left ankle can be a fashion statement or simply a decorative accessory. In some cases, the meaning of an anklet worn on the left ankle may be personal and specific to the individual wearing it, the options are truly endless. Over time, we have seen the meaning of anklets diminish in Western culture. Now they are usually just worn as a fashion accessories.
